Friday: Arrival, Sunset, and Waterfront Dining
3:00 PM - 5:00 PM: Arrive and Settle In. Check into your accommodation, whether it's a beachfront resort, a cozy condo, or a vacation rental. Take a moment to unpack, throw on your swim gear, and get ready to hit the sand. Marco Island is easy to navigate, so you'll be feeling at home in no time.
5:00 PM - 7:00 PM: Sunset at South Beach. No visit to Marco Island is complete without witnessing a breathtaking Gulf Coast sunset. Head directly to South Beach, located at the southernmost tip of the island. Parking is available at the public access points, though it can fill up quickly, especially on a Friday evening – consider carpooling or an early arrival. Spread your towel, relax, and watch the sky explode with color. This is the perfect introduction to your laid-back weekend.
7:30 PM - 9:30 PM: Dinner with a View at Snook Inn. For your first Marco Island dinner, make your way to the iconic Snook Inn (check ahead for reservations as it's a popular spot). This waterfront restaurant offers fresh seafood, lively atmosphere, and often live entertainment. Enjoy classic Florida dishes like grouper or shrimp, all while overlooking the tranquil waterways. It's a quintessential Marco Island experience and a great way to kick off your trip.

Saturday: Dolphin Encounters and North Beach Adventures
9:00 AM - 10:00 AM: Breakfast at Doreen's Cup of Joe. Start your day right with a hearty breakfast at Doreen's Cup of Joe. Known for its delicious coffees, generous portions, and friendly service, it's a local favorite. Expect a bit of a wait, especially on a Saturday morning, but it's well worth it for their pancakes, omelets, or breakfast burritos.
10:30 AM - 1:00 PM: Dolphin and Shelling Tour. Embark on an unforgettable dolphin and shelling excursion. Several reputable tour operators depart from various marinas around the island, such as Rose Marina or Isles of Capri Marina (a short drive off-island). Look for tours that specifically mention exploring the Ten Thousand Islands National Wildlife Refuge. You'll likely see playful dolphins in their natural habitat and stop at secluded barrier islands, accessible only by boat, to hunt for unique seashells. Wear your swimsuit, bring sunscreen, a hat, and a bag for your shell treasures.
1:30 PM - 2:30 PM: Lunch at The Esplanade. After your morning adventure, head to The Esplanade on Marco Island, an open-air shopping and dining complex with beautiful waterfront views. Grab a casual lunch at places like CJ's on the Bay or comparable spots offering fresh salads, sandwiches, and seafood with a view of the marina. It’s a great place to people-watch and enjoy the ambiance.
2:30 PM - 5:30 PM: Relax and Play at North Beach. Spend your afternoon unwinding at North Beach, Marco Island's largest public beach. With miles of soft, white sand and gentle Gulf waters, it's perfect for swimming, sunbathing, or simply strolling along the coastline. You might even spot some unique shorebirds. Public access points are available, often with metered parking. Bring beach essentials like towels, chairs (some vendors offer rentals, check ahead), and plenty of water.

Sunday: Mangrove Kayaking and Departure
9:30 AM - 10:30 AM: Brunch at The Crabby Lady. Enjoy a delicious farewell brunch at The Crabby Lady, known for its creative breakfast and lunch options, often with a seafood twist. It's a more casual spot with a friendly vibe, perfect for a relaxed Sunday morning meal.
11:00 AM - 1:00 PM: Kayaking Through the Mangroves. Before you head home, immerse yourself in Marco Island's unique ecosystem with a kayak or paddleboard adventure through the winding mangrove tunnels. Several outfitters offer rentals and guided tours, departing from various points including locations near the Collier County Park. This offers a peaceful, close-up encounter with Florida's natural beauty, allowing you to paddle through calm waters and spot local wildlife like wading birds and small fish. It's a fantastic way to experience a different side of the island.
